About Bolt Bolt is shaping a future where cities are built for people, not cars. What started as an ambitious project of a 19-year-old in 2013 has grown into a global mobility platform used by more than 200 million customers and 4.5 million driver and courier partners across 50 countries. From ride-hailing and food delivery to scooters, e-bikes, and car-sharing, Bolt helps people move through cities every day. Small, autonomous teams drive this work, combining the speed and ownership of a startup with the scale of a global technology company backed by more than €1bn in funding. About the role We’re looking for a Senior Performance Marketing Specialist to take the wheel of our rider acquisition strategy in select markets. In this role, you’re not just managing campaigns—you’re owning the performance marketing results in both new and established markets. You’ll have the autonomy to test bold ideas, own budget allocation, optimise across our core channels, and set the standard for what "good" looks like at Bolt - both in terms of channel setup and growth scaling. Main tasks and responsibilities: Own the end-to-end growth roadmap and lead budget experimentation strategies to maximize ROI and identify scalable opportunities across core business verticals for allocated markets. Design, manage, and scale high-impact performance campaigns across Google, Meta, and TikTok, ensuring all activities are optimized for user acquisition and key business KPIs. Lead a rigorous testing culture by designing and executing tests for budget allocation, creatives, platform betas and optimisations to drive continuous growth improvements. Lead performance marketing user acquisition efforts in a given region / set of markets. This includes collaborating with local stakeholders and taking into account local context and market performance when planning experiments and executing optimisations. Deeply analyze creative performance across all platforms, translating data into actionable insights to guide the creative team and iterate on high-performing assets. Partner closely with Martech & Analytics, Brand, Vertical marketing teams to align on growth initiatives, experimentation, documentation of results. Monitor budget pacing and metrics (Paybacks, CPA, iROI) and provide data-backed recommendations for quarterly budget planning and performance reviews or marketing activities and proactively suggest adapting the best examples. About you: You have experience optimising and scaling campaigns across Google, Meta, and TikTok, with a deep understanding of ad platform mechanics and best practices, as well as technical setup. You have a proven track record of managing 5-digit (or higher) monthly budgets across multiple markets and taking full accountability for end-to-end growth roadmaps and ROI results. You have a strong analytical mindset, experience running incrementality and conversion lift tests to evaluate channel performance based on incremental CPA, ROI and payback, and are confident using web and app attribution tools such as GA4 and MMPs like AppsFlyer, Adjust or Singular. You can translate creative performance data into actionable insights for creative teams and analyse it effectively to help inform future production (basic knowledge of Figma or Canva a bonus). You are a self-driven project manager who independently ideates testing initiatives, creates comprehensive action plans, and communicates results clearly across cross-functional teams.
